seniorEnsemble Learning
What is ensemble learning for high-dimensional data problems?
Updated May 16, 2026
Short answer
Ensemble learning handles high-dimensional data by reducing variance and selecting informative feature subsets.
Deep explanation
High-dimensional datasets suffer from sparsity and overfitting. Ensemble methods like Random Forest, Gradient Boosting, and Extra Trees reduce dimensionality issues by selecting random feature subsets at each split or model. This introduces implicit feature selection and reduces variance. Stacking with dimensionality reduction techniques like PCA can further improve robustness. Ensembles are especially effective when features are redundant or highly correlated.
Real-world example
Used in genomic analysis where thousands of gene features exist.
Common mistakes
- Using linear models without regularization in high-dimensional settings.
Follow-up questions
- Why do trees work well in high dimensions?
- What is the curse of dimensionality?